Going into studying the rules with zys we're finding a whole bunch more doubts on the book... for starters

Rule 2-7-1-c states:
c. A valid or invalid fair catch signal deprives the receiving team of the
opportunity to advance the ball, and the ball is declared dead at the spot
of the catch or recovery or at the spot of the signal if the catch precedes
the signal (Rule 6-5-1-a Exception).

What does "or at the spot of the signal if the catch precedes
the signal" means?
